uDig is a desktop geographic information service (GIS) development platform. It was created by Refractions Research, which has been churning out GIS-related software since 1998. Read more about uDig.

Volunteers world-wide work on this open source desktop application. Most of the focus for uDig is on database viewing and editing. Even today, updates continue to roll in. But the interface really just needs a fresh coat of paint.

uDig, an acronym for User-friendly, Desktop application, Internet-based, and GIS (uDig) software solution is another free, open-source, and cross-platform compatible GIS software. The GIS software was developed to utilize and comply with OGC’s OpenGIS standards like WFS, WMS, etc. The software is intuitive and provides a single-click installation process. With uDig, users...

But its strength comes in its framework design, being built around the same Eclipse IDE that many developers are familiar with already. In this way, uDig makes it easy to develop your own GIS application which meets the specific needs of your users. The project's gallery hosts many examples, from smart grid to forestry to logistics.
